kurkuma
08.06.2012 10:09 _
Короче, вот вам быдлокодерский костыль-плагин для /recent: http://rghost.ru/38549709
ЖС нихуя не знаю, в процессе написания этого говна (15 минут) налуркал. И так:
var gays = ['Velvet-Bird', 'z_']
массив с геями, корочи, указываем там нежелательных персон
var opacity = '0.5';
прозрачность их постов. 0 — полностью прозрачный, 1 — полностью непрозрачный. обязательно в кавычках.
Recommended by:
@hongweibing,
@0verMind
Не качайте там вирус~
9-строчный вирус на жопоскрипт
Еще и не работает.
апдейт. теперь по наведению становятся нормальными: http://rghost.ru/38549934
на хабре, кстати, пиздец черезжопно сделаны эти прозрачные посты. только с жабаскриптом нормально работает — неосилили :hover мудаки
как проверить содержится ли строка в списке? лол у меня нихуя не выходит
хотя я разобрался лол
хз, в php есть функция in_array()
ослоёбы сосут хуйцы, остальные пруцца!
var pidors = ["z_", "Kirsche", "lexszero"]
var opacity = "0.5"
var posts = document.getElementsByClassName("post");
for (var post in posts) {
var name = posts[post].getElementsByTagName("a")[1].firstChild.nodeValue;
if (pidors.indexOf(name) != -1) {
posts[post].setAttribute("style", "opacity:"+opacity);
}
}
вот что я накорябал. мой первый код на JS. не знаю как правильно итерировать по словарю. но в целом работает
лучше не стиль добавляй, а класс какой-нибудь типа "gay", как я в апдейте сделал. а в стилях уже прописываешь:
.gay{
opacity: 0.3;
}
.gay:hover{
opacity: 1;
}
чтобы при наведении прозрачность убиралась
хорошо